Output 8515784c523583007a3463757200294f4e5e80d8ce57c836eb3bfb1e1d5f1640:0

value
543574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f43e2b18ee4d77cc3188911fcd535058bc46befa OP_EQUAL
address
3PxTGtAg5H7DQKsEmyoYcMzeNioArGtLq6
transaction
8515784c523583007a3463757200294f4e5e80d8ce57c836eb3bfb1e1d5f1640
spent
true